Ten years after being launched into deep space and clocking billions of miles across the solar system, the Rosetta spacecraft has caught up with comet 67P/Churyumov-Gerasimenko.
The Philae lander on Wednesday separated from the Rosetta orbiter and became the first spacecraft to achieve a soft landing on a comet.
